Introduzione
Se si usa l'applicazione di messaggistica Slack per la comunicazione interna, Docebo può integrarsi con essa, consentendo la configurazione delle notifiche della piattaforma da inviare tramite Slack.
Analogamente a qualsiasi altra notifica della piattaforma, le notifiche Slack possono essere programmate e assegnate a gruppi specifici, rami, corsi e piani formativi, e possono essere inviate al team tramite messaggi diretti (dal bot Docebo nel messaggio privato Slackbot) o tramite canali pubblici.
Nota bene:
- Il motore di notifica legacy non è supportato da Docebo per Slack versione 2.
- Per coloro che stanno effettuando la migrazione da Docebo per Slack versione 1, si prega di consultare la sezione Migrare da Docebo per Slack versione 1 a versione 2.
- Slack impone un limite di frequenza di un messaggio al secondo per utente o canale. L'integrazione di Docebo con Slack non può superare tale limite. Se la piattaforma genera notifiche a una frequenza superiore, alcuni messaggi potrebbero essere messi in coda o subire ritardi.
Migrare da Docebo per Slack versione 1 a versione 2
Prima di iniziare
Docebo per Slack versione 1 utilizza il motore di notifica legacy di Docebo. Al contrario, Docebo per Slack versione 2 si avvale del nuovo motore di notifica. Pertanto, al rilascio del nuovo motore di notifica, tutti gli utenti di Docebo per Slack versione 1 sono stati esclusi dalla migrazione dal motore di notifica legacy.
In pratica, la migrazione da Slack versione 1 a versione 2 comporta due fasi: un cambiamento nell'integrazione e, successivamente, una migrazione al nuovo motore di notifica, eseguita da Docebo per vostro conto.
Per effettuare la migrazione da Slack versione 1 a versione 2 senza interruzioni, è necessario seguire i passaggi nell'ordine indicato di seguito:
- Configurare l'integrazione Docebo per Slack versione 2.
Questo passaggio deve essere eseguito per primo in quanto abilita la possibilità di essere migrati al nuovo motore di notifica. Inoltre, garantisce che, una volta migrata la piattaforma di apprendimento al nuovo motore di notifica, le notifiche tramite Slack continueranno senza interruzioni. - Migrare il motore di notifica dal legacy.
Una volta completato con successo, Docebo per Slack versione 2 gestirà le notifiche senza interruzioni. - Resettare Docebo per Slack versione 1.
Questo passaggio rimuoverà le connessioni legacy all'account Slack dall'integrazione versione 1, che non fornisce più alcuna funzionalità.
Dettagli della migrazione
Per migrare da Docebo per Slack versione 1 a versione 2, iniziare configurando l'integrazione Docebo per Slack versione 2 seguendo i capitoli successivi a partire da Attivare l'app Slack versione 2 nella piattaforma e assicurarsi che la configurazione sia salvata.
Successivamente, contattare il customer success manager o un agente di supporto per attivare il nuovo motore di notifica della piattaforma. Si riceve conferma dell'avvenuta ricezione della richiesta e si è informati non appena il motore di notifica sarà stato attivato. Si precisa che questo non è un processo automatico e potrebbe richiedere diversi giorni per essere completato. Le notifiche esistenti saranno migrate alla nuova infrastruttura di notifica.
Avvertenza: Se si attiva il nuovo motore di notifica della piattaforma prima di configurare Docebo per Slack versione 2, si cessa di ricevere notifiche. È pertanto fondamentale seguire l'ordine delle istruzioni riportate in questo capitolo.
Una volta attivato il nuovo motore di notifica, disattivare Docebo per Slack versione 1 come descritto nel capitolo Eseguire il Reset della Configurazione di Docebo per Slack.
Consiglio: Sebbene l'integrazione versione 2 sia operativa immediatamente come descritto in questo documento, non si ricevono notifiche della piattaforma tramite Slack versione 2 fino a quando il nuovo motore di notifica non sarà stato attivato con successo in Docebo. Nel frattempo, le notifiche saranno fornite dall'integrazione Slack versione 1.
Per continuare a ricevere notifiche, mantenere attiva la versione 1 dell'integrazione in parallelo, affinché una volta completata la migrazione del motore di notifica, la nuova integrazione possa assumere il controllo e fornire tali servizi senza interruzioni.
Attivare l'app Slack versione 2 nella piattaforma
Attivare l'app Slack V2 come descritto nell'articolo Gestire Applicazioni e Funzionalità della knowledge base. L'applicazione è elencata nella scheda Integrazioni Software Terzi.
Configurare Slack in Docebo
Per configurare Slack nella piattaforma, assicurarsi innanzitutto di aver effettuato l'accesso al proprio account Slack con privilegi amministrativi. Quindi, accedere al menu di navigazione, individuare la voce Componenti aggiuntivi e integrazioni (icona a puzzle) e selezionare l'elemento Slack V2.
Successivamente, cliccare sul pulsante Configura Slack per procedere.
Se si è già connessi a Slack nello stesso browser, cliccare su Consenti nella schermata successiva; in caso contrario, effettuare il login a Slack e seguire le istruzioni per autorizzare l'integrazione a connettersi al workspace Slack.
Nota bene: È necessario essere connessi a Slack come amministratore o come utente con ruolo di amministratore dell'integrazione per poter collegare Docebo per Slack V2 al workspace Slack.
L'integrazione Slack utilizzerà i seguenti ambiti all'interno di Slack:
-
incoming-webhook- Consente la creazione di webhook unidirezionali per inviare messaggi a un canale specifico. -
commands- Permette l'aggiunta di scorciatoie e/o comandi slash utilizzabili dagli utenti. -
channels:read- Consente la visualizzazione di informazioni di base sui canali pubblici in un workspace. -
team:read- Permette di visualizzare il nome, il dominio email e l'icona dei workspace a cui Learning Hub è connesso. -
users:read- Consente la visualizzazione degli utenti presenti in un workspace. -
users:read.email- Permette di visualizzare gli indirizzi email degli utenti in un workspace. -
users.profile:read- Consente la visualizzazione dei dettagli del profilo degli utenti in un workspace.
Una volta completata con successo la connessione, si è reindirizzati alla pagina delle proprietà di Slack V2.
Successivamente, nella pagina delle Impostazioni utente, sarà necessario mappare l'identificatore utente Slack con l'identificatore utente Docebo. Si ricorda che in Docebo solo i valori ID utente e Nome utente sono unici di default.
Nota bene: Per una mappatura e aggiornamenti accurati degli utenti, gli identificatori utente Slack e Docebo devono coincidere. Se l'ID utente Slack differisce, gli utenti non saranno mappati (quando si utilizza il metodo di mappatura) oppure saranno creati come nuovi utenti con l'ID utente Slack, senza essere collegati a un account Docebo esistente (quando si utilizza il metodo di provisioning).
Sincronizzazione utenti
Successivamente, selezionare il metodo di sincronizzazione desiderato. È possibile utilizzare il metodo di mappatura utenti, che associa un utente Slack a un utente Docebo esistente, oppure il metodo di provisioning utenti. La mappatura utenti collegherà un utente Slack a un utente Docebo esistente senza creare nuovi utenti da Slack a Docebo. Il provisioning utenti consentirà invece di creare nuovi utenti all'interno di Docebo, abbinando i campi selezionati per la sincronizzazione.
Mappatura utenti
Il metodo di mappatura utenti consente di sincronizzare rapidamente gli utenti esistenti in Docebo con la base utenti Slack. Una volta selezionato l'identificatore utente corretto da utilizzare, assicuratevi che nella sezione Metodo di sincronizzazione sia attivata l'opzione Attiva mappatura utenti.
Successivamente, cliccate su Salva le modifiche per attivare la sincronizzazione.
Provisioning utenti
Attivando il provisioning utenti, si sincronizzano gli utenti Slack in Docebo. Per iniziare, selezionare il pulsante di opzione Attiva provisioning utenti nella sezione Metodo di sincronizzazione.
Successivamente, selezionare il ramo predefinito in cui verranno inseriti i nuovi utenti cliccando sul pulsante Seleziona il ramo. Dopo aver scelto il ramo appropriato, confermare cliccando su Seleziona.
Nota bene: Se un utente è già stato inserito in Docebo prima dell'implementazione di questa integrazione, potrebbe essere spostato nel ramo selezionato nell'integrazione.
Successivamente, se si desidera aggiornare le informazioni degli utenti per tutti gli utenti esistenti, cliccare sul pulsante Aggiorna le informazioni per gli utenti esistenti. Se si desidera notificare agli utenti la creazione del loro account in Docebo, selezionare la casella di controllo Invia notifica Utente creato (se esistente).
A questo punto, scegliere quali campi in Docebo si vuole associare ai campi in Slack. I seguenti campi sono obbligatori e non possono essere rimossi dalla lista dei campi da associare:
- Nome utente
- Indirizzo email
- Nome
- Cognome
Per modificare o impostare una mappatura di campo, cliccare sul menu a tendina nell'area campo Slack del campo che si vuole modificare e selezionare un elemento dalla lista disponibile di campi in Slack.
Nota bene: Il campo selezionato come identificatore nella sezione Identificatore utente non può essere modificato o eliminato.
Se si vuole mappare campi aggiuntivi in Slack, cliccare sul pulsante Aggiungi campi e, nella finestra a comparsa, selezionare i campi da aggiungere, quindi cliccare su Aggiungi.
Successivamente, si possono mappare i campi aggiuntivi come fatto per i campi obbligatori. Per rimuovere campi aggiunti, cliccare sull'icona del cestino alla fine della riga di ciascun campo aggiuntivo.
Al termine della configurazione, cliccare su Salva le modifiche.
Impostazioni di sincronizzazione
Nella scheda Sincronizzazione, per impostazione predefinita è abilitata l'opzione che consente di sincronizzare i dati utente con Slack ogni volta che un utente viene creato o modificato in Slack. Ciò permette una sincronizzazione automatica dei dati utente al verificarsi di un aggiornamento. Se si sceglie di disattivare questa opzione, sarà necessario cliccare sul pulsante Sincronizza nella sezione Sincronizzazione manuale ogni volta che si desidera aggiornare il provisioning o la mappatura degli utenti.
Nota bene: La sincronizzazione manuale esegue un import completo dei dati e sovrascriverà gli utenti precedentemente mappati con nuove informazioni. Tale operazione dovrebbe essere eseguita soltanto in caso di errori nelle precedenti configurazioni e solo dopo aver effettuato una sincronizzazione. A seconda del numero di utenti mappati, questa procedura potrebbe richiedere un tempo considerevole.
Gestire la connessione esistente
La scheda Connessione nell'integrazione Slack v2 consente di visualizzare informazioni relative al nome del workspace connesso e all'ID del team. Questi dati sono disponibili nella sezione Dettagli della scheda Connessione.
Per resettare la connessione con Slack, cliccare sul pulsante Resetta dati.
Nota bene: Premendo il pulsante Resetta dati verranno rimossi tutti i dati mappati e gli identificatori utente Slack dal sistema, oltre a eliminare la connessione con Slack. Questa operazione non rimuoverà gli utenti provisionati in Docebo e non potrà essere annullata.
Successivamente, nella finestra di conferma, cliccare su Resetta.